* linux-user: Fix accept4(SOCK_NONBLOCK) syscallHelge Deller2023-07-081-1/+11
| | | | | | | | | | | | | | | | | | | The Linux accept4() syscall allows two flags only: SOCK_NONBLOCK and SOCK_CLOEXEC, and returns -EINVAL if any other bits have been set. Change the qemu implementation accordingly, which means we can not use the fcntl_flags_tbl[] translation table which allows too many other values. Beside the correction in behaviour, this actually fixes the accept4() emulation for hppa, mips and alpha targets for which SOCK_NONBLOCK is different than TARGET_SOCK_NONBLOCK (aka O_NONBLOCK). The fix can be verified with the testcase of the debian lwt package, which hangs forever in a read() syscall without this patch. * linux-user: Fix fcntl() and fcntl64() to return O_LARGEFILE for 32-bit targetsHelge Deller2023-07-081-0/+4
| | | | | | | | | | | | | | | | When running a 32-bit guest on a 64-bit host, fcntl[64](F_GETFL) should return with the TARGET_O_LARGEFILE flag set, because all 64-bit hosts support large files unconditionally. But on 64-bit hosts, O_LARGEFILE has the value 0, so the flag translation can't be done with the fcntl_flags_tbl[]. Instead add the TARGET_O_LARGEFILE flag afterwards. Note that for 64-bit guests the compiler will optimize away this code, since TARGET_O_LARGEFILE is zero. * linux-user: Emulate /proc/self/smapsIlya Leoshkevich2023-07-031-1/+57
| | | | | | | | | | | | | | | | | | | | /proc/self/smaps is an extension of /proc/self/maps: it provides the same lines, plus additional information about each range. GDB uses /proc/self/smaps when available, which means that generate-core-file tries it first before falling back to /proc/self/maps. This, in turn, causes it to dump the host mappings, since /proc/self/smaps is not emulated and is just passed through. Fix by emulating /proc/self/smaps. Provide true values only for Size, KernelPageSize, MMUPageSize and VmFlags. Leave all other values at 0, which is a valid conservative estimate. * linux-user: Avoid mmap of the last byte of the reserved_vaRichard Henderson2023-07-011-4/+10
| | | | | | | | | | | | | | | | There is an overflow problem in mmap_find_vma_reserved: when reserved_va == UINT32_MAX, end may overflow to 0. Rather than a larger rewrite at this time, simply avoid the final byte of the VA, which avoids searching the final page, which avoids the overflow. * target/i386: emulate 64-bit ring 0 for linux-user if LM feature is setPaolo Bonzini2023-06-291-30/+27
| | | | | | | | | | | | | | | | | | 32-bit binaries can run on a long mode processor even if the kernel is 64-bit, of course, and this can have slightly different behavior; for example, SYSCALL is allowed on Intel processors. Allow reporting LM to programs running under user mode emulation, so that "-cpu" can be used with named CPU models even for qemu-i386 and even without disabling LM by hand. Fortunately, most of the runtime code in QEMU has to depend on HF_LMA_MASK or on HF_CS64_MASK (which is anyway false for qemu-i386's 32-bit code segment) rather than TARGET_X86_64, therefore all that is needed is an update of linux-user's ring 0 setup. * linux-user: Return EINVAL for getgroups() with negative gidsetsizePeter Maydell2023-06-101-2/+2
| | | | | | | | | | | | | | | | | | | Coverity doesn't like the way we might end up calling getgroups() with a NULL grouplist pointer. This is fine for the special case of gidsetsize == 0, but we will also do it if the guest passes us a negative gidsetsize. (CID 1512465) Explicitly fail the negative gidsetsize with EINVAL, as the kernel does. This means we definitely only call the libc getgroups() with valid parameters. It also brings the getgroups() code in to line with the setgroups() code. Possibly Coverity may still complain about getgroups(0, NULL), but that would be a false positive. | * linux-user: fix getgroups/setgroups allocationsMichael Tokarev2023-05-171-31/+68
| |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| linux-user getgroups(), setgroups(), getgroups32() and setgroups32() used alloca() to allocate grouplist arrays, with unchecked gidsetsize coming from the "guest". With NGROUPS_MAX being 65536 (linux, and it is common for an application to allocate NGROUPS_MAX for getgroups()), this means a typical allocation is half the megabyte on the stack. Which just overflows stack, which leads to immediate SIGSEGV in actual system getgroups() implementation. An example of such issue is aptitude, eg https://bugs.debian.org/cgi-bin/bugreport.cgi?bug=811087#72 Cap gidsetsize to NGROUPS_MAX (return EINVAL if it is larger than that), and use heap allocation for grouplist instead of alloca(). While at it, fix coding style and make all 4 implementations identical. Try to not impose random limits - for example, allow gidsetsize to be negative for getgroups() - just do not allocate negative-sized grouplist in this case but still do actual getgroups() call. But do not allow negative gidsetsize for setgroups() since its argument is unsigned. Capping by NGROUPS_MAX seems a bit arbitrary, - we can do more, it is not an error if set size will be NGROUPS_MAX+1. But we should not allow integer overflow for the array being allocated. Maybe it is enough to just call g_try_new() and return ENOMEM if it fails. Maybe there's also no need to convert setgroups() since this one is usually smaller and known beforehand (KERN_NGROUPS_MAX is actually 63, - this is apparently a kernel-imposed limit for runtime group set). The patch fixes aptitude segfault mentioned above. | * linux-user: Don't require PROT_READ for mincoreThomas Weißschuh2023-05-171-1/+1
| |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| The kernel does not require PROT_READ for addresses passed to mincore. For example the fincore(1) tool from util-linux uses PROT_NONE and currently does not work under qemu-user.
